Two students from Dawei Technological University arrested

Two students from Dawei Technological University were arrested in Dawei, Tanintharyi Region, the locals confirmed to Than Lwin Times.

Ko Myo Min Oo, a former political prisoner who was working for a company in Khonewindap Ward, Dawei, was again taken into custody by the military council on September 12.

Ko Myo Min Oo was detained for more than 5 months for staging a protest against the military dictatorship last year, and now he was arrested again after being released on amnesty.

Similarly, Ko Aung Wayan Tun, a student of Dawei Technological University, was arrested at his home in Kyatsarpyin ward by the military council on September 11.

At least 30 locals, including members of the Dawei Youth Strike Committee, have been arrested in Dawei Township in the past two weeks, and most of them are in the interrogation center.

Currently, the military council has tightened security in Dawei Township and is making numerous arrests under the pretext of overnight guest registration while conducting searches and inspections.
